Hi all,
I just got a 2010 Rogue 360 last week. Before buying, I read about vibration issues devloping with the CVT, so maybe I am being overly cautious here....

I have noticed when I accelerate out of a turn, maybe in the 10-15 mph range, there is a brief "brrrrrrr" kind of vibration, lasting only a second or so. It does not seem to happen when accelerating on a straight line.

I know the AWD model starts from stationary in AWD mode, then switches to FWD, so maybe it is that switchover I am feeling more while the wheels are turned?

Just wondered if this is normal or worth mentioning to the dealer?

Hello murpheeee,

Welcome to the NICOClub Rogue Forums!

I am sure the vibration you are feeling is the result of the AWD system. I have not noticed this in my FWD Rogue.

The other vibration issues mentioned in this forum are not a defect, but rather the result of Nissan's CVT programming and are normal. Nissan gears the CVT quite high for for fuel efficiency, the resulting vibration at low speeds is much like 'lugging' a manual transmission car in high gear.
